Matchstick Coffee is located on Fraser and Kingsway, just a few stores down from Les Faux Bourgeois. M and I were eating nearby and a coworker suggested we walk a block over to try his favourite coffee spot.
It’s a little bit hidden, but if you walk around, you’ll find the big ‘M’.
This place is pretty hip. A good place to chill with friends, do some work on your laptop, or have a meeting.
The space is pretty perfect and the interior is aesthetically pleasing.
They sell their coffee as beans and even have some little pastries.
Almond Milk Latte ($3.75) I tried getting soy but that wasn’t an option. I’ve never had a latte with almond milk before, but it really made this latte taste weird. Also almost sour tasting. It was hard to drink.
Cold El Llano Brewed Coffee ($3.25) was ordered by M and he loved it. He liked the taste as it had hints of macadamia nuts and plum.
Overall, it’s a great place for brewed coffee, but stay away from the Almond Milk Lattes. I’d definitely come again for a regular latte and just sit and chill here.
